In addition to this, carbohydrates from the bacteria are also responsible for peaks such as 1267 cm −1, 1259 cm −1 in addition to 1265 cm −1 (COH, HCO, ... WebNov 13, 2024 · Premasiri et al. [56,57,58] used gold nanoparticle SiO 2 substrates to obtain SERS spectra of bacteria. The aggregated gold nanoparticle coated SiO 2 matrix was produced by a multistep in-situ growth procedure. A gold ion doped sol-gel was formed by the hydrolysis of tetramethoxysilane in an acidic methanol solution of HAuCl 4. A sodium ...
